قَالَ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 ( صلى الله عليه وآله ) شَارِبُ الْخَمْرِ إِنْ مَرِضَ فَلَا تَعُودُوهُ وَ إِنْ مَاتَ فَلَا تَحْضُرُوهُ وَ إِنْ شَهِدَ فَلَا تُزَكُّوهُ وَ إِنْ خَطَبَ فَلَا تُزَوِّجُوهُ وَ إِنْ سَأَلَكُمْ أَمَانَةً فَلَا تَأْتَمِنُوهُ .


Translation

Abu Ali Al Ashary, from Muhammad Bin Abdul Jabbar, from Safwan, from Al A’ala, from one of his companions, (It has been narrated) from Abu Abdullah<sup>asws</sup> having said: ‘Rasool-Allah<sup>saww</sup> said: ‘The wine drinker, if he were to fall sick, so do not console him, and if he dies, so do not attend it (funeral), and if he were to testify, so do not ratify him, and if he proposes, so do not give in marriage to him, and if he were to ask you for an entrustment, so do not entrust it to him’.


Book (Kitab)كتاب الْأَشْرِبَةِ
Chapter (Bab)باب شَارِبِ الْخَمْرِ
CollectionAl-Kafi

Compiled by Shaykh Muhammad ibn Ya'qub al-Kulayni
